Cement grinding Vertical roller mills VS ball mills
Prehydration of cement can, when exceeding a certain level, lead to reduced reactivity of the cement and thus longer setting times and reduced strengths, particularly early strengths. Prehydration can also enhance the tendency of false set in cement with a high content of dehydrated gypsum.

Effects of Environmental Exposure on Portland Cement Type …
It was found that prehydration converted hemihydrate to gypsum and partially transformed the principal cement phases and inherent portlandite into carbonates, thus reducing C3S and C2S while increasing CaCO3 and gypsum. Hydration was slowed down with a delay in the appearance of the aluminate peak and reduction in cumulative heat at 72 h.

Reducing pre-hydration in a VRM
However, cement produced in VRMs sometimes has lower strength and longer setting time compared to ball-mill cements made with the same raw materials. In most cases, pre-hydration of the cement, due to the presence of moisture inside the VRM, is a significant factor. ... There are two approaches to reducing prehydration in a VRM:
